VSA & ! light

So I was sitting in the drive through line at CVS dropping off a prescription, when all of a sudden my VSA & ! light came on.I had just gotten off of the highway from my 50 mile commute. When I pressed the VSA switch, nothing happened. I couldn't turn VSA back on.The car drove fine going home, but the lights stayed on. I just started it again to see if they would come on again. Both lights did not come back on, but when I pressed the VSA button, the ! came on, but not the VSA light. When I pressed the VSA button again, the ! light went back off. All of my brake lights are working. I did check that. Each time I pressed my brake light, I could hear a click that seemed to be coming from directly under the shifter (I have an Automatic).

Has anyone else experienced this? I searched an read other posts, but I did not find another post that had all of my symptoms. The engine light never came on.

Could be the cold messing with the sensors.

On the 2G RLs Its ice interfering with the sensors. I've read where you turn the car off, restart and drive it at more than 20mph, everything goes back to normal. If the warnings remain despite one or 2 "restarts", take it to a pressure wash and give the brakes a good wash, if that doesn't do the trick, its dealer time.
